
filter_var
PHP8存在大量向后不兼容变更,如移除mysql_*函数、强化类型系统、禁用隐式转换、新增ValueError/TypeError等,需分阶段升级并全面适配代码、扩展及第三方库。
PHP获取短链真实URL后,用file_put_contents()写入带时间戳的txt文件,或用fputcsv()生成含BOM的CSV;直接下载则需header()设置类型与附件名,再通过php:/...
本文介绍一种安全、精准的PHP正则方案,用于将纯文本中的URL自动转换为HTML链接,同时智能忽略句号、逗号、感叹号等结尾标点,并跳过已包裹在标签内的链接。
控制器仅负责请求分发与数据流转,不处理业务逻辑;方法命名须遵循RESTful规范;校验须前置且解耦;响应构造须通过框架机制统一管理。
需通过四种方式动态获取苹果支付产品列表:一、调用AppStoreServerAPI解析inAppPurchaseList;二、从MySQL表apple_products查询预设商品;三、解析iOS客户...
PHP8.4分页需用PDO预处理+LIMIT/OFFSET,严防SQL注入与高偏移性能问题;推荐游标分页替代OFFSET,URL参数须用http_build_query自动编码。
PHP数据库操作需严谨处理空值:插入时用isset/empty判断并绑定NULL;更新时按字段约束选择置NULL或跳过;查询时区分ISNULL与=‘’;删除前校验ID合法性;ORM中通过casts和m...
PHP生成静态页时可用五种方法实现CSSGrid布局:一、内联样式;二、外链CSS文件;三、PHP变量动态控制列数与间距;四、模板片段组合;五、CSS-in-PHP内联样式属性。
PHP处理表单需确保HTML中form的method和action正确、输入字段有name属性;用isset()和!empty()判断数据存在与非空,filter_input()或filter_var...
验证PHP搜索与过滤逻辑正确性的五种测试方法:一、预设数组单元测试;二、模拟HTTP请求测试表单过滤;三、filter_var_array批量验证多字段;四、异常输入测试防御能力;五、assert()...